Triggers tell the oscilloscope exactly when to start drawing the signal. Without a proper trigger, your wave will drift across the screen.

They look nearly identical. The DOS1102 is Hanmatek’s rebranded version of the same hardware platform. Consequently, the Hantek manual is often 95% accurate for the Hanmatek. However, always prefer the Hanmatek-specific manual for warranty and software tools.
Do not attempt without reading the manual first. A failed firmware update can brick the device. The official manual provides the exact file naming convention and USB port to use (USB Host, not USB Device).
